With SQL you can create tables within a database, add and
delete data, query for information, change system settings, and
trigger actions based on changes to the database. Whether you're
a programmer, administrator, or database designer, Teach
Yourself SQL in 21 Days, Second Edition provides all the
information needed to fully understand this powerful tool and use
it to its fullest potential.
Using step-by-step instructions, real-world examples, and
expert advice, you'll improve your productivity, taking your
skills to new heights. Completely updated and revised, this
easy-to-understand guide explores SQL, showing you how to
construct and optimize queries, use stored procedures and
triggers to tune a database for maximum performance, and master
the fundamental concepts and features of SQL.
